Source code for RsCmwWcdmaSig.Implementations.Configure_.Cell_.Rcause

from ....Internal.Core import Core
from ....Internal.CommandsGroup import CommandsGroup
from ....Internal import Conversions
from .... import enums


# noinspection PyPep8Naming,PyAttributeOutsideInit,SpellCheckingInspection
[docs]class Rcause: """Rcause commands group definition. 6 total commands, 0 Sub-groups, 6 group commands""" def __init__(self, core: Core, parent): self._core = core self._base = CommandsGroup("rcause", core, parent) # noinspection PyTypeChecker
[docs] def get_rrc_request(self) -> enums.RejectCause: """SCPI: CONFigure:WCDMa:SIGNaling<instance>:CELL:RCAuse:RRCRequest \n Snippet: value: enums.RejectCause = driver.configure.cell.rcause.get_rrc_request() \n Enables or disables the rejection of RRC connection requests and selects the rejection cause to be transmitted. \n :return: reject_cause: CSCongestion | CSUNspecific | PSCongestion | PSUNspecific | ON | OFF CS/PS congestion, CS/PS unspecific reason Additional parameters: OFF | ON (disables | enables the rejection of requests) """ response = self._core.io.query_str('CONFigure:WCDMa:SIGNaling<Instance>:CELL:RCAuse:RRCRequest?') return Conversions.str_to_scalar_enum(response, enums.RejectCause)
[docs] def set_rrc_request(self, reject_cause: enums.RejectCause) -> None: """SCPI: CONFigure:WCDMa:SIGNaling<instance>:CELL:RCAuse:RRCRequest \n Snippet: driver.configure.cell.rcause.set_rrc_request(reject_cause = enums.RejectCause.CSCongestion) \n Enables or disables the rejection of RRC connection requests and selects the rejection cause to be transmitted. \n :param reject_cause: CSCongestion | CSUNspecific | PSCongestion | PSUNspecific | ON | OFF CS/PS congestion, CS/PS unspecific reason Additional parameters: OFF | ON (disables | enables the rejection of requests) """ param = Conversions.enum_scalar_to_str(reject_cause, enums.RejectCause) self._core.io.write(f'CONFigure:WCDMa:SIGNaling<Instance>:CELL:RCAuse:RRCRequest {param}')
# noinspection PyTypeChecker
[docs] def get_location(self) -> enums.RejectionCauseA: """SCPI: CONFigure:WCDMa:SIGNaling<instance>:CELL:RCAuse:LOCation \n Snippet: value: enums.RejectionCauseA = driver.configure.cell.rcause.get_location() \n Enables or disables the rejection of location update requests and selects the rejection cause to be transmitted. \n :return: cause_number: C2 | C3 | C4 | C5 | C6 | C11 | C12 | C13 | C15 | C17 | C20 | C21 | C22 | C23 | C25 | C32 | C33 | C34 | C38 | C48 | C95 | C96 | C97 | C98 | C99 | C100 | C101 | C111 | ON | OFF C2: IMSI unknown in HLR C3: Illegal mobile subscriber C4: IMSI unknown in VLR C5: IMEI not accepted C6: Illegal mobile equipment C11: PLMN not allowed C12: Location area not allowed C13: Roaming not allowed in location area C15: No suitable cells in location area C17: Network failure C20: MAC failure C21: Synch failure C22: Congestion C23: GSM authentication unacceptable C25: Not authorized for this CSG C32: Service option not supported C33: Requested service option not subscribed C34: Service option temporarily out of order C38: Call cannot be identified C48: retry upon entry into a new cell C95: Semantically incorrect message C96: Invalid mandatory information C97: Message type non-existent or not implemented C98: Message type not compatible with protocol state C99: Information element non-existent or not implemented C100: Conditional information element error C101: Message not compatible with protocol state C111: Protocol error, unspecified Additional OFF | ON disables | enables the rejection of requests """ response = self._core.io.query_str('CONFigure:WCDMa:SIGNaling<Instance>:CELL:RCAuse:LOCation?') return Conversions.str_to_scalar_enum(response, enums.RejectionCauseA)
[docs] def set_location(self, cause_number: enums.RejectionCauseA) -> None: """SCPI: CONFigure:WCDMa:SIGNaling<instance>:CELL:RCAuse:LOCation \n Snippet: driver.configure.cell.rcause.set_location(cause_number = enums.RejectionCauseA.C100) \n Enables or disables the rejection of location update requests and selects the rejection cause to be transmitted. \n :param cause_number: C2 | C3 | C4 | C5 | C6 | C11 | C12 | C13 | C15 | C17 | C20 | C21 | C22 | C23 | C25 | C32 | C33 | C34 | C38 | C48 | C95 | C96 | C97 | C98 | C99 | C100 | C101 | C111 | ON | OFF C2: IMSI unknown in HLR C3: Illegal mobile subscriber C4: IMSI unknown in VLR C5: IMEI not accepted C6: Illegal mobile equipment C11: PLMN not allowed C12: Location area not allowed C13: Roaming not allowed in location area C15: No suitable cells in location area C17: Network failure C20: MAC failure C21: Synch failure C22: Congestion C23: GSM authentication unacceptable C25: Not authorized for this CSG C32: Service option not supported C33: Requested service option not subscribed C34: Service option temporarily out of order C38: Call cannot be identified C48: retry upon entry into a new cell C95: Semantically incorrect message C96: Invalid mandatory information C97: Message type non-existent or not implemented C98: Message type not compatible with protocol state C99: Information element non-existent or not implemented C100: Conditional information element error C101: Message not compatible with protocol state C111: Protocol error, unspecified Additional OFF | ON disables | enables the rejection of requests """ param = Conversions.enum_scalar_to_str(cause_number, enums.RejectionCauseA) self._core.io.write(f'CONFigure:WCDMa:SIGNaling<Instance>:CELL:RCAuse:LOCation {param}')
